If you are looking for a guideline for treatment, ICSI is notable for their generous use of evaluation and treatment algorithms, flow charts and indication of levels of evidence.The Institute for Clinical Systems Improvement is a collaborative of insurance companies and hospitals which produces guidelines for patient care. Clinicians from member organizations survey scientific literature and draft health care recommendations based on the best available evidence. These documents are subjected to an intensive review process that involves physicians and other health care professionals from ICSI member organizations before they are made available for general use.
